Independent Women’s Forum is seeking a dedicated intern to serve with the design team in our communications department for 20-30 hours per week.

Types of Activities Include:
  • Creation of social media marketing graphics
  • Design, layout, and production of long-form documents
  • Creation of event materials
Requirements:
  • Must have experience in InDesign, Adobe Illustrator, and Adobe Photoshop. Familiarity and experience in Adobe Premiere is a plus
  • Be committed to our belief in conservative policy and passion for developing and advancing policies that aren’t just well-intended, but actually enhance people’s freedom, opportunities, and well-being.
  • Have excellent organizational and communication skills
  • Be a self-starter who can work independently and collaboratively in a fast-paced virtual organization
  • Have a strong work ethic, and be impact-oriented
  • Do the right things the right way
  • Have attention to detail
  • Be teachable and eager to learn
Other Details:

The design intern reports to IW’s Graphic Design Lead.

IW operates as a virtual office. While we maintain regular working hours, our virtual office means staff spends more time getting things done and less time sitting in traffic. Still, we understand the importance of personal relationships, which is why we remain in constant daily communication, hold weekly staff and department calls, and host quarterly in-person meetings.

Interns at IW will receive a stipend, one-on-one guidance, connection with like-minded women, and opportunities for growth.
